I just checked out the site- good job!
The site looks very clean and organized. The fact that you have a search feature really helps a lot. I really like the fact that you used pictures to display the products. You wouldn't believe how some e-commerce sites just list products without pictures and expect people to buy!
One thing I would like to add is less is better when it comes to number of clicks. I noticed there's quite a few clicks you have to go through when it comes to purchasing or completing the transaction (about 7 clicks from main page to checkout). Maybe you can combine some of the steps so that it's all on one page and processes once, minimizing the number of clicks. From a business/marketing standpoint, you want to make it so that it's as quick and easy as possible for the consumer to purchase the product. Some people have really slow connections, and sometimes an extra click or two makes the difference in a completed transaction or one that might be canceled because there's too many steps involved and frustration. Think of when you go to a store and they have those impulse items near the register- it doesn't give people time to think about it or change their mind.
Hope this helps- good luck with your site! It's looking good! |

I think that the products need better descriptions.
For example, the dimensions should be listed with each item.
The thumbnail sized photos are fine, but you need to let the customer click on them to get a bigger, better image and description.
If they can't be there to see it in person, you need great photos and a great description, with specifications, to sell it. |
